._form{background:transparent!important;margin:0 auto!important;padding:0!important}._form,._form-content{display:flex!important;justify-content:center!important;width:100%!important}._form-content{align-items:center!important;flex-wrap:wrap!important;margin:20px 0!important;max-width:700px!important}._button-wrapper,._form_element{display:flex!important;flex-direction:column!important}._form-content._single-row{flex-wrap:nowrap!important;justify-content:space-between!important;width:100%!important}._form-content._single-row ._button-wrapper,._form-content._single-row ._form_element{flex-basis:auto!important;width:auto!important}._form-content._single-row ._button-wrapper{padding-right:0!important}._form-content._single-row button{flex:0 1 auto!important;width:auto!important}._button-wrapper,._form_element{flex-basis:100%!important}@media (min-width:768px){._form-content{flex-wrap:wrap!important;justify-content:center!important}._form-content._single-row{flex-wrap:nowrap!important}._form_element{flex:1 1 45%!important}._form_element._full_width{flex:0 0 100%!important}._button-wrapper{flex:0 1 auto!important;padding-right:0!important}}@media (max-width:767px){._form-content{flex-direction:column!important;flex-wrap:nowrap!important;justify-content:center!important}._button-wrapper,._form_element{flex-basis:100%!important;padding-right:0!important}}._form._inline-style ._button-wrapper{margin:0 20px 10px!important}._form-label{display:none!important}._form-content button,._submit{font-family:acumin-pro,sans-serif!important;font-size:20px!important;line-height:normal!important;margin-top:0!important;padding:10px 20px!important;white-space:nowrap}.input,input,select,summary,textarea{-webkit-appearance:none!important;-moz-appearance:none!important;appearance:none!important;background-color:#fff!important;border:.0625rem solid #d8d8d8!important;border-radius:8px!important;color:#1c1c1c!important;font-family:acumin-pro,sans-serif!important;font-size:1rem!important;font-weight:400!important;line-height:1.7!important;width:100%!important}.hidden{display:none!important;margin:0!important;padding:0!important}._form._inline-style ._button-wrapper.nopadding{margin:0 0 10px!important}